Merge pull request #594 from pcworld/narrow-view-notification

Fix notifications in narrow view when content is hidden
pull/604/head
DeepBlueV7.X 4 years ago committed by GitHub
commit 1ace482c74
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
  1. 6
      src/ChatPage.cpp
  2. 5
      src/ChatPage.h

@ -1197,6 +1197,12 @@ ChatPage::getProfileInfo()
}); });
} }
bool
ChatPage::isRoomActive(const QString &room_id)
{
return isActiveWindow() && content_->isVisible() && currentRoom() == room_id;
}
void void
ChatPage::hideSideBars() ChatPage::hideSideBars()
{ {

@ -207,10 +207,7 @@ private:
void getProfileInfo(); void getProfileInfo();
//! Check if the given room is currently open. //! Check if the given room is currently open.
bool isRoomActive(const QString &room_id) bool isRoomActive(const QString &room_id);
{
return isActiveWindow() && currentRoom() == room_id;
}
using UserID = QString; using UserID = QString;
using Membership = mtx::events::StateEvent<mtx::events::state::Member>; using Membership = mtx::events::StateEvent<mtx::events::state::Member>;

Loading…
Cancel
Save